GRAEME THOMAS KING UPPED TO SERIES REGULAR FOR MGM+'S "ROBIN HOOD" SEASON TWO
LOS ANGELES - July 29, 2026 - MGM+, the premium linear channel and streaming service, today announced that Graeme Thomas King has been upped to series regular for Season Two of Robin Hood, reprising his role as Prince John, the cunning younger son of King Henry II whose ambition and shifting loyalties intensify the kingdom's growing power struggle.
Production on Season Two of Robin Hood is currently underway in Serbia, and will premiere on MGM+ across the U.S., UK, Italy, Germany, Spain, Latin America, Belgium, the Netherlands, and Luxembourg.
Robin Hood is produced by Lionsgate Television, with showrunner John Glenn, director Jonathan English, and Hidden Pictures' Todd Lieberman serving as executive producers. Seth Yanklewitz, CSA, oversees casting for MGM+.
